Bloodstone, also known as heliotrope, is a deep green gemstone dotted with striking red flecks of iron oxide. Ancient warriors carried it for courage, while healers used it to stabilize energy and detoxify the body. Metaphysically, bloodstone is revered as a stone of vitality and emotional resilience. Its energy connects to the root and heart chakras, grounding the spirit while nurturing compassion and release.
